Ya esta disponible Windows App SDK 2.0 y representa un hito técnico fundamental para el ecosistema de Windows 11. Parece que en Microsoft están trabajando todo lo que no han hecho durante los últimos años. Aunque es una actualización de bajo nivel que no introduce cambios visuales inmediatos para el usuario, establece los nuevos cimientos para que las aplicaciones nativas sean más coherentes, estables y capaces de procesar inteligencia artificial de forma local. Aquí tienes los detalles clave de esta nueva versión.
Windows Apps SDK 2.0 consigue mejores cimientos: ¿Qué cambia frente a la versión 1.8?
Vamos a desgranar las novedades para que todos lo entendamos y como afecta a Windows 11. Cabe destacar que esto solo afectará a Windows 11 cuando Microsoft o cualquier desarrollador lo incorpore a sus aplicaciones. Mientras que la versión 1.8 se centró en abrir las puertas a la IA y modelos locales, la versión 2.0 llega para consolidar y ordenar la plataforma.
Gestión de archivos moderna: Los nuevos Storage Pickers permiten a las aplicaciones recordar estados por instancia y seleccionar múltiples carpetas en una sola operación, evitando que los diálogos de archivos se sientan como piezas inconsistentes del sistema.
Interfaces dinámicas: La nueva API IXamlCondition permite que las interfaces se adapten mejor al cargar solo los elementos necesarios según las capacidades del dispositivo o configuraciones experimentales.
Estética de Windows 11: Gracias a SystemBackdropElement, las aplicaciones pueden integrar efectos como Mica o Acrylic dentro de cualquier elemento del diseño, logrando una mayor coherencia visual con el resto del sistema operativo.
Inteligencia Artificial y Rendimiento
Microsoft ha refactorizado componentes clave para hacer que el sistema sea más modular y eficiente:
IA Modular: Se han separado funciones de Windows ML para reducir dependencias innecesarias, permitiendo que las aplicaciones que usan IA local no arrastren componentes que no necesitan.
Instalaciones más fiables: Nuevas APIs de validación comprueban certificados y requisitos de versión antes de instalar paquetes, lo que debería traducirse en menos errores de instalación para el usuario final.
Mejoras en apps híbridas: Se ha añadido soporte para arrastrar contenido (imágenes, HTML, texto) desde WebView2 en aplicaciones WinUI 3, mejorando la fluidez en aplicaciones que mezclan contenido web y nativo.
El futuro: IA local y herramientas avanzadas
La versión experimental de este SDK revela la hoja de ruta de Microsoft hacia un sistema más inteligente que no dependa constantemente de la nube. Algo que ya hemos visto que quieren hacer con la nueva app de Concentración:
Súper resolución de vídeo: Pruebas para mejorar la calidad de vídeo mediante IA local.
Búsqueda avanzada: Mejoras en el indexador de contenido de aplicaciones que incluyen consultas sobre texto detectado mediante OCR en imágenes.
Modelos de lenguaje: Generación de respuestas estructuradas utilizando modelos de lenguaje que se ejecutan directamente en el dispositivo.
Windows App SDK 2.0 es un elemento clave para construir un Windows menos fragmentado. El éxito real se verá cuando las aplicaciones cotidianas adopten estas APIs para ofrecer menos consumo de recursos y una IA local mejor integrada. Veremos si Microsoft empieza a implementar estas mejoras en sus apps y podemos disfrutar de un Windows 11 mejorado.

